What does a Garmin measure that relates to gastroparesis?

A Garmin is a wrist-worn wellness device, and everything it reports comes from sensors pressed against your skin. It reads continuous wrist heart rate all day and night. From the beat-to-beat timing of that signal it calculates HRV Status, a picture of your heart rate variability over several nights. It estimates a Body Battery score from 0 to 100 that tries to sum up your energy reserves. It tracks a Stress score, blood oxygen through Pulse Ox, your respiration rate, and your sleep stages.

None of those numbers touch your digestive tract. What some of them do touch is your autonomic nervous system, the automatic wiring that runs your heart, your breathing and, yes, your gut motility. Gastroparesis means delayed gastric emptying, and the vagus nerve is a big part of how food moves through the stomach in the first place. When that same nervous system is under strain, your heart rate and HRV often shift too. That’s the thread a Garmin can pick up. It’s an indirect one, but on rough days it’s real.

Think of it as watching the weather vane rather than the wind. The vane tells you something true about which way things are blowing. It just isn’t the wind itself.

Can a Garmin detect a gastroparesis flare?

Not directly, and this is the honest answer worth sitting with. A flare of nausea, early fullness, bloating and pain is a GI event. Your Garmin has no sensor for any of it. It cannot see nausea, it cannot feel your stomach struggling to empty, and it will never put a number on how full you feel after three bites of dinner.

What it can sometimes show is the wake behind the flare. On a bad stretch, plenty of people notice a higher resting heart rate, a dip in HRV Status, a Body Battery that drains fast and refuses to recharge, and broken sleep. Those are the autonomic and recovery signals reacting to what your gut is doing. Be careful, though. A poor night’s sleep, a hard workout, a cold coming on, a stressful week, dehydration, all of these move the same numbers. A low HRV reading is not proof of a flare, and a normal one is not proof you’re fine. The watch gives you a hint, not a diagnosis.

Can a Garmin track the autonomic side of gastroparesis?

This is where a Garmin earns its place. Gastroparesis frequently overlaps with dysautonomia, a broad term for a nervous system that struggles to regulate itself, and with vagus nerve dysfunction specifically. The vagus nerve helps run both your digestion and your heart rhythm, which is exactly why a heart-based metric can echo a gut-based problem.

HRV Status is the headline here. Heart rate variability reflects the balance between the two halves of your autonomic nervous system, and low variability often points to a body stuck in a stressed, sympathetic-heavy state. If your baseline HRV is persistently low or keeps dropping, that’s a signal worth noticing and worth mentioning to your clinician, especially if you also live with symptoms like dizziness on standing or a racing heart. Continuous heart rate adds context. A resting heart rate that creeps up over days, or big jumps when you stand, can reflect autonomic strain. Body Battery and Stress round it out with a rough energy and load estimate. Read together, over weeks rather than hours, these give you a portrait of how hard your nervous system is working. They still don’t tell you a thing about your gastric emptying. For that, there’s no shortcut around a gastric emptying study ordered by a specialist.

Is a Garmin good for gastroparesis?

It depends on what you’re asking it to do. As a tool for tracking your gut, a Garmin is the wrong instrument. It measures none of the things that define gastroparesis. If someone sells you a watch as a way to monitor your stomach, they’re overselling it.

As a tool for tracking your body’s response to gastroparesis, it can be quietly helpful. The autonomic and recovery data can add a layer of evidence to what you already feel, and having numbers to point at can make you feel a bit less like you’re imagining things on a hard week. A few limits to hold onto:

  • Wrist heart rate is less accurate than a chest strap, especially during movement, so treat single readings as rough.

  • A Garmin is a wellness device at heart. It does not diagnose anything and it isn’t validated to manage gastroparesis.

  • The numbers describe stress and recovery, not digestion. Every metric is an indirect proxy.

  • Individual days are noisy. Trends over weeks are where the signal lives.

Used with those caveats in mind, a Garmin can be a decent companion. Used as a replacement for medical care, it will let you down.

How to use a Garmin well with gastroparesis

  • Watch trends, not single readings. One low HRV morning means little. A two-week slide means more.

  • Log your symptoms, meals and medications by hand so the wearable numbers have something to sit against. The context is what makes the data readable.

  • Wear it consistently, including overnight, since sleep and resting heart rate are where the most useful signals show up.

  • Treat every score as a proxy for your autonomic and recovery state, never as a measure of your gut.

  • Keep your GI specialist in the loop and rely on a proper gastric emptying study for diagnosis and treatment decisions. The watch supports the conversation. It doesn’t replace it.

FAQ

Can a Garmin diagnose gastroparesis?

No. Gastroparesis is diagnosed with a gastric emptying study, usually ordered by a gastroenterologist, which measures how quickly food actually leaves your stomach. A Garmin is a wellness device with no way to assess digestion, so it can’t diagnose or rule out the condition. According to the NHS, delayed stomach emptying needs proper medical testing to confirm.

Why does my heart rate go up during a gastroparesis flare?

Your autonomic nervous system links your gut and your heart, partly through the vagus nerve, so when your digestion is struggling your heart rate and HRV can shift in response. Mayo Clinic notes that damage to the vagus nerve is a common factor in gastroparesis, which helps explain why the same nervous system that runs your stomach also affects your heart rhythm. A Garmin can pick up that heart response, though it can’t see the gut event causing it.

Should I use a chest strap instead of my Garmin wrist sensor?

For everyday resting heart rate and overnight HRV trends, the wrist sensor is fine and far more practical. A chest strap is more accurate during movement and exercise, so if you’re chasing precise readings around activity, it’s the better tool. For tracking autonomic patterns over weeks, consistent wrist wear usually matters more than absolute accuracy.

Can a Garmin replace seeing my doctor?

No. A Garmin can add useful context and help you describe patterns you’ve noticed, but it isn’t validated to manage gastroparesis and doesn’t diagnose anything. Keep your GI specialist involved and let the wearable support those conversations rather than stand in for them.
